1

A flat ring or perforated disc of metal, rubber, or plastic placed under a nut or bolt head or at a joint to distribute pressure, prevent leakage, or act as a spacer.

Don't forget to put a washer between the bolt and the surface.

2

A machine for washing clothes, dishes, or other items.

I need to buy a new washer because my old one broke.
